Aligned Expands Presence in Salt Lake Metro Area With New Waterless Build-to-Scale Data Center

Aligned Expands Presence in Salt Lake Metro Area With New Waterless Build-to-Scale Data Center

ย Aligned, a leading data center provider offering innovative, sustainable and adaptable colocation and build-to-scale solutions for cloud, enterprise, and managed service providers, announces its continuing expansion in the Salt Lake Metro Area with the development of the Companyโ€™s new data center campus. Aligned acquired the new multi-megawatt site for its latest waterlessย Build-to-Scaleย development. The expansion further supports its geo-redundant growth in the region, following the Q1 2021 launch of its second Salt Lake Metro data center, SLC-02, and in advance of a third master-planned facility on itsย West Jordan, Utah, campus. The project is forecasted to meet an aggressive six-month construction timeline, with completion projected in December of 2021.

โ€œOur latest Salt Lake data center is an example of Alignedโ€™s ability to provide agile Build-to-Scale solutions focused on driving optionality, reducing added cost and risk, and enabling industry-leading construction timelines and quality,โ€ saysย Andrew Schaap, CEO of Aligned. โ€œIn addition to speed and scale, the development also satisfies our customerโ€™s requirement for water conservation, while still delivering industry-leading Power Usage Effectiveness (PUE). Combined with our ultra-efficient Delta3ย cooling technology, Utahโ€™s cold desert climate enables us to deliver a waterless data center solution.โ€

Aligned SLC-04 combinesย the Companyโ€™s patented and award-winning Delta3โ„ขย cooling technologyย with a state-of-the-art waterless heat rejection system. This technology delivers meaningful efficiency enhancements across rising rack densities and next-generation workloads for maximum flexibility and adaptability, regardless of altitude or geographical climate zone. Alignedโ€™sย Deltaยณ cooling systems also allows customers to Expand on DemandTM, incrementally scaling in place up to 50 kW per rack without stranding capacity.

Alignedโ€™s build-to-suit solutions, known as Build-to-Scale, are delivered at an unprecedented speed and built for optimum scale to solve the complex needs of todayโ€™s large enterprises and hyperscalers. From campuses to custom data center deployments, Aligned can complete a Build-to-Scale project in any location, preemptively evaluating sites across multiple facets in multiple markets to minimize development timeframes. Alignedโ€™s vendor-managed inventory (VMI), a key aspect of its advanced supply chain methodology, also mitigates inventory constraints and logistical challenges, ensuring the Companyโ€™s prefabricated, factory-built and tested power and cooling equipment is always ready for immediate deployment.
